Garder une textbox en Focus.

Ageofskull Messages postés 22 Date d'inscription mardi 19 mai 2009 Statut Membre Dernière intervention 10 juin 2009 - 9 juin 2009 à 12:04
Ageofskull Messages postés 22 Date d'inscription mardi 19 mai 2009 Statut Membre Dernière intervention 10 juin 2009 - 10 juin 2009 à 08:27
Calu les gens !

Alors me revoila avec un nouveau probleme.

J'ai une textbox, qui , si l'utilisateur tape un matricule inconnue de la BDD, envoit un msgbox indiquant l'erreur. Seulement j'aimerai que mon curseur reste sur la textbox, afin que l'utilisateur puisse directement le corriger plutot que d'avoir a recliquer dans le champs.

Un petit bou de code :

While Not rst.EOF


    If Texte28 = rst!SOCSECNUM Then
        Texte23 = rst!lastname & "    " & rst!firstname


        d = True
       


    End If
rst.MoveNext
Wend
If d = False Then
Texte28.SetFocus
MsgBox "Le numéro que vous avez saisie n'est pas connu dans mp2", vbInformation, "ATTENTION"
Texte23 = ""
Texte28.BackColor = 255
'j'ai bien rajouter un texte28.setfocus ici, mais cela ne marche pas =(

Texte28 est le textbox que je voudrais garder en focus.
Merci d'avance !

3 réponses

Ageofskull Messages postés 22 Date d'inscription mardi 19 mai 2009 Statut Membre Dernière intervention 10 juin 2009
9 juin 2009 à 12:06
Je n'ai pas mis la suite du code qui est juste un Else / end if classique avec un changement de couleur de textbox a l'interieur, rien d'important ;)
0
Ageofskull Messages postés 22 Date d'inscription mardi 19 mai 2009 Statut Membre Dernière intervention 10 juin 2009
9 juin 2009 à 15:09
Personne ne peut m'aider alors? ='(
0
Ageofskull Messages postés 22 Date d'inscription mardi 19 mai 2009 Statut Membre Dernière intervention 10 juin 2009
10 juin 2009 à 08:27
Up....
0
Rejoignez-nous